| | Hybrid Dove??? Hello everyone. I am a new user on this forum. I have recently seen this Dove in my garden, it is always alone and gets cgased away by the collard doves who also visit. It is an odd colouration, could anyone help me identify it please. |

| | | Re: Hybrid Dove??? Hi Pajmazza and welcome to WAB!
It looks like a Collared Dove,but it is a leucistic one.
Cheers Jason |

| | | Re: Hybrid Dove??? Thank you for your replies. Leucistic isn't a term I was familiar with. I " Googled it" and am now even more fascinated than before. The poor thing is always alone, spends hours a day in my garden. The other collared Doves that visit will chase it away, it appears to have a slightly deformed foot too.
Is it a rarity??? should I tell someone???

| | | Re: Hybrid Dove??? Hi Pajamazza.
Leucistic birds like this are frequent,so this isn't really that rare at all,I'm afraid.
Cheers Jason. |
